Need some last minute ideas? No problem! As you can see, it’s really easy (though not always the most recognizable) to go with some of your favorite movie and television characters. I’ve also really rocked some musician costumes, and some off the wall ideas (like the wind, a parrot, so on lol). Try to avoid buying “costumes” sold together in a package. Instead, focus on utilizing or purchasing items that you will use again; this makes for a really quality looking get up. Be creative and have fun!
